Juliana P. Sánchez is a scholar working on Parasitology, Genetics and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Juliana P. Sánchez has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 244 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Parasitology, 27 papers in Genetics and 14 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Juliana P. Sánchez’s work include Vector-borne infectious diseases (28 papers), Yersinia bacterium, plague, ectoparasites research (25 papers) and Animal Ecology and Behavior Studies (12 papers). Juliana P. Sánchez is often cited by papers focused on Vector-borne infectious diseases (28 papers), Yersinia bacterium, plague, ectoparasites research (25 papers) and Animal Ecology and Behavior Studies (12 papers). Juliana P. Sánchez collaborates with scholars based in Argentina, Israel and South Africa. Juliana P. Sánchez's co-authors include Marcela Lareschi, Waldo Sepúlveda, Carlos Schnapp, Edgardo Corral, Rodrigo A. Vásquez, M. Mónica Díaz, Rubén M. Bárquez, Daniel E. Udrizar Sauthier, J. Antonio Gutierrez and Santiago Nava and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Ecography and Trends in Parasitology.
